What is Teeth Whitening?

Teeth whitening is a cosmetic procedure often performed by dentists with professional equipment and techniques. Teeth “whitening” rarely makes teeth totally white, but instead lightens the teeth several shades with each treatment until the teeth reach the desirable color. Teeth whitening materials and techniques vary, but usually use a combination of different chemical compounds that effectively remove stains from teeth.

Benefits of Teeth Whitening

The main benefit of teeth whitening is that it is a relatively cost-effective way to get lighter, brighter teeth. Many patients complain that their teeth have yellowed over time, or have become stained from drinking coffee and consuming other abrasive or acidic fluids or foods. While teeth whitening won’t reverse the effects, it can lighten the teeth back to their original shade, or even lighter. Most patients claim that after teeth whitening they feel a sense of pride, confidence, and increased self-esteem.

Risks and Drawbacks of Teeth Whitening

Teeth whitening is not for everyone, which is why it’s important to first consult with a dentist before you engage in any teeth whitening procedures. Dental implants often do not respond in the same way to whitening procedures, for example, and whitening will need to be coordinated by dental professionals to ensure the best results possible. As we mentioned before, some individuals experience mild discomfort in their teeth after whitening. There are other risks and drawbacks of teeth whitening that apply to individual circumstances, so it’s most important to consult with your dentist beforehand.
